Well here I am a little over 6 weeks post op and doing well. I did have one minor set back about 3 weeks after surgery when I had an episode where something was stuck and had some vomiting which caused the dr. to remove some fluid from the band. He took out 2 cc's. I didn't even know I had 2 cc's in the band! I went the following week for my first fill as scheduled but he only put 1.5 cc's back in. My dr. only does fills every 7-8 weeks. I am not scheduled for a 2nd fill until October 11th. I do feel some restriction now but not as much as I should. I can eat more than I should in the evenings. I had read lots of people on here that stated that and thought it was strange but now I suffer from the same phenomenon. I can't eat very much at all at breakfast, a little more at lunch, but dinner time I really need to practice self control or I could probably eat whatever I wanted. I am hoping my 2nd fill will tighten me up enough to avoid that. I am officially down 21 pounds. I am happy with the weight loss but haven't really lost anything other than maybe a pound or so in the past 2 weeks. I know I need to amp up working out as I haven't been doing enough of that, only walking really. I used to work out all the time but just haven't found my mo jo again for that yet. Just walking the trail at the park is rough for me. And I have only done that like once a week. I know if I increase my exercise quantity/quality I will see better results. But even knowing that, I still am having a hard time motivating myself. I hope that it clicks on soon and I get it in gear!! Just wanted to post an update so that I can record my journey.
